An essential amino acid is an amino acid that cannot be synthesised by the organism being considered, and therefore must be supplied in its diet. The nine amino acids humans cannot synthesise are phenylalanine, valine, threonine, tryptophan, methionine, leucine, isoleucine, lysine and histidine.
